Welcome to the Glimmerfall on-call rotation! One thing that trips people up: partner files from Orvane Logistics land in our SFTP drop every night around 02:00, and the ingest worker (fetchling) pulls them into the staging bucket. If fetchling stalls, check the drop first — usually it's an empty folder, not a real outage. To poke the ingest API manually, authenticate with the key below.

gateway credential: zpat7_4Y3Gskp

## TICKET-2290 — Signature check failure, greenhouse drift-correction update

The Verdacline greenhouse controller rejected the v3.4 firmware that fixes the humidity sensor drift issue. Verification failed because the controllers still trust last quarter's signing key, which was rotated last week. Support should advise affected sites to update the trust bundle before retrying the install; no hardware fault is involved. For reference when updating customer trust bundles, the current signing key is below.

deploy key for kajof-fajop: bky6_gDHw9Q

Subject: Ownership change for the Nightglass backfill scheduler

Hello plugin authors,

As of next Monday, responsibility for the Nightglass nightly backfill scheduler is moving to a new maintainer. Plugin hooks, cron registration APIs, and the retry policy interface remain unchanged, so no code updates are required on your side. However, future deprecation notices and compatibility reviews will route through the new owner, so please direct scheduler questions accordingly. The new responsible maintainer is named below.

approver of bagug-bagag = Holael Pramir

## Releases

Proctorline queue builds are cut from the release branch after the review checklist passes. Reviewers should confirm the queue drain test and the invigilator-session replay both succeed in CI before approving a tag. Artifacts are built reproducibly and signed by the Hallmoor pipeline. When verifying a candidate build locally, check the artifact signature against the release signing key shown below.

signing key of fahof-tahof = bky13_rpcUNgEnLB4i2